Set in a secluded location on the edge of the Nidderdale Area of Outstanding Natural Beauty, the property is a tranquil spot, yet ideally situated for visiting a range of fantastic attractions including Fountains Abbey and Studley Royal, Newby Hall, Ripley Castle and Brimham Rocks. Locally, the area offers two pubs, an ice-cream parlour, a grocery shop and luxury spa treatments at a nearby hotel. Ripon itself is a North Yorkshire gem, balancing a rich cultural heritage with exciting contemporary living, with its imposing Cathedral, fascinating museums and a bustling market square. The Blue House is an excellent base for countryside rambles and unrushed time spent with loved ones. Walkers will delight in the beautiful Yorkshire Dales location, with routes of all lengths right from the door. Wildflower meadows, Bluebell Woods and Heather Moors can all be experienced without using a car. For golfers, there are several courses including an 18-hole course at Ripon and 9-hole at Masham. For a spot of shopping, the spa town of Harrogate is just 12 miles away.

This newly renovated, extended 17th century cottage with plenty of bucolic charm is set off the beaten track amidst miles and miles of Yorkshire Dales countryside. Head up the path from the parking area and make your way into the cottage hewn from York stone. For all its history and authentic country charm, the house is every inch a contemporary property, with underfloor heating beneath the kitchen flagstones ensuring a toasty welcome even before you stoke the fires. Within the kitchen are all the appliances an aspiring chef could wish for, including an electric range hob and oven, double fridge/freezer and dishwasher, microwave, bread machine and pod coffee machine. The spacious dining area is a convivial spot to toast the day, with plenty of room to fit everyone comfortably around the tables. Open the doors to the large wraparound patio where your group can spread out and enjoy the celebrations, with tables and chairs for all. Inside, there are two social spaces where younger people can retreat to play games or simply watch TV while the adults enjoy the evening elsewhere. The main sitting room and the snug room, both on the first floor, come complete with capacious sofas, smart TV’s and multi-fuel stoves to warm the toes on chilly nights. Gather round to chat about the day or enjoy some traditional entertainment with a board game, or head downstairs to the games room to play some pool. There are eight well-appointed bedrooms, all boasting country views as well as quality mattresses to guarantee a blissful night’s rest. Four bedrooms are on the ground floor: two with super-king-size zip-and-link beds (one with en-suite shower and WC), one with king-size and one double. One of the super-king bedrooms includes an additional single bed plus a pull-out single bed – ideal for families with younger children. The remaining four bedrooms are upstairs, all with super-king-size zip-and-link beds; one includes an en-suite shower room with WC and a pull-out single bed. All super-king beds can be made into twins with prior request. In addition, there is a house bathroom on the first floor and one bathroom and one shower room on the ground floor, all with WCs.

Externally, you are spoilt for space. The house is situated within 10 acres, rich in wildlife, where you are free to roam (dependent on season and farm livestock). The generous garden lends well to entertaining, with a large charcoal BBQ and two patio areas with outdoor seating overlooking the spectacular rural vistas beyond. The firepit area, complete with stone seating, is the perfect way to end the day. There is also a games barn where you can play table-tennis, which doubles as secure storage for your bikes. Whether you are here to walk, cycle, indulge your creative side or simply sit back and relax, you will be sure to want to come back for more.
